Domain 1: English Language ProficiencyA student reads a short passage and is asked to identify what the passage is mostly about. Which reading comprehension skill is being tested?
Correct answer: B
Explanation
The main idea is the central point or overall subject a passage is mostly about. Questions about what a text is mostly about test a reader’s ability to identify the main idea. — fcice_syllabus.txt
Why each option is right or wrong
A. Identifying the meaning of a single vocabulary word
Vocabulary meaning focuses on individual words, not the overall subject of a passage.
B. Determining the main idea of the passage
The prompt asks what the passage is mostly about, which directly tests main idea. The source material lists "Main idea" as the reading comprehension topic and key term for this skill.
C. Recalling a minor supporting detail from the passage
Supporting details are specific facts, not the passage’s central point.
D. Deciding whether the author agrees with the reader
Author agreement is not the stated reading skill; the task is identifying the passage’s overall subject.
